HVAC Commissioning: Essential Elements for Performance
Effective climate commissioning is absolutely vital for ensuring optimal system operation. It's process goes beyond simple start-up; it involves a comprehensive verification that every system component functions according to the intent and owner's requirements. A well-executed commissioning plan includes several vital aspects, such as:
- Assessment of equipment setup and order of operations.
- Checking control strategies and values.
- Logging of every results and corrective actions.
- Training of operations team on proper equipment usage.
Finally, proper building commissioning provides better energy efficiency, minimized service charges, and a improved satisfying indoor atmosphere for users. Neglecting this crucial process can lead to costly repair problems down the future.
